From: Shock assisted ionization injection in laser-plasma accelerators

Influence of the shock position, the laser energy and the electron density on the beam properties.
(a) Peak energy as a function of the shock position, for ne = 5.3 ± 0.4 × 1018 cm−3. (b) Electron beam energy and charge as a function of the laser energy, for ne = 5.6 ± 0.3 × 1018 cm−3. (c) Beam charge and energy as a function of the electron density. In (b,c) the shock position is zs = −1.02 ± 0.02 mm. Error bars indicate the standard deviation.
